快速参考
- 篮球投篮:常见约 0.9–1.3 s;彩虹三分可到 ~1.4–1.6 s(再长就很罕见)
- 足球高球/解围:~2–3 s;守门员开大脚或高抛可更久
- 橄榄球开球/弃踢:4.5–5.5 s(顶级水平)
- 棒球高飞球:5–7 s 也常见
物理上怎么估
- 同高度出手与落点时,飞行时间 T = 2 v0 sinθ / g
- 只知道最高点相对出手高度 h 时:T ≈ 2√(2h/g)。例:h=3 m → T≈1.56 s
可能“看起来更久”的原因
- 慢放/高帧率视频;镜头跟拍球路;出手点与落点高度差;强背旋让轨迹更“飘”
